Antidumping and Countervailing Duty Notices for Dec. 28

The Commerce Department and the International Trade Commission published the following Federal Register notices Dec. 28 on AD/CVD proceedings:

  • Aluminum Extrusions from the People’s Republic of China (A-570-967/C-570-968): Notice of Court Decisions Not in Harmony with Final Scope Ruling and Notice of Amended Final Scope Rulings Pursuant to Court Decisions (here)
  • Certain Large Diameter Carbon and Alloy Seamless Standard, Line and Pressure Pipe from Japan (A-588-850): Final Results of the Expedited Sunset Review of the Antidumping Duty Order (here)
  • Certain Steel Nails from the United Arab Emirates (A-520-804): Final Results of the Expedited Second Sunset Review of the Antidumping Duty Order (here)
  • Finished Carbon Steel Flanges from India (C-533-872): Final Results of Countervailing Duty Administrative Review; 2020; Correction (here)
  • Large Diameter Welded Pipe from Canada (A-122-863): Amended Final Results of Antidumping Duty Administrative Review; 2020-2021 (here)
  • Stilbenic Optical Brightening Agents from People’s Republic of China and Taiwan (A-570-972, A-583-848): Final Results of Sunset Reviews and Revocation of Order (here)
  • Welded ASTM A-312 Stainless Steel Pipe from the Republic of Korea and Taiwan (A-580-810, A-583-815): Continuation of Antidumping Duty Orders (here)
  • Welded Line Pipe from the Republic of Korea (A-580-876): Preliminary Results of Antidumping Duty Administrative Review and Preliminary Determination of No Shipments; 2020-2021 (here).
